MINNESOTA ACCOUNTS FOR 10 PERCENT OF U.S. JOB GROWTH AGAIN IN JULY -- August 15, 2006
Minnesota added jobs for the 13th straight month in July with an increase of 11,600 jobs, according to figures released today by the Department of Employment and Economic Development (DEED) On average, Minnesota's job gains over the past four months account for 10 percent of the nation's job growth.

GOVERNOR PAWLENTY REQUESTS AGRICULTURAL DISASTER DECLARATION FOR 36 MINNESOTA COUNTIES -- August 8, 2006
Governor Tim Pawlenty today sent a letter to U.S. Secretary of Agriculture Mike Johanns requesting a federal agricultural disaster be declared for 36 Minnesota counties, which would allow drought-impacted farmers and ranchers to receive low-interest loans from the U.S. Department of Agriculture.

GOVERNOR PAWLENTY ANNOUNCES THAT HIGHWAYS 59 AND 19 TO REMAIN PRINCIPAL ARTERIES -- August 7, 2006
Governor Pawlenty announced today that there will be no change in classification for U.S. Highway 59 from Marshall to Worthington and Minnesota Highway 19 from Redwood Falls to Marshall. The Minnesota Department of Transportation (Mn/DOT) had recommended a change in classification for the highway stretches as part of a regular review process.
